Holy Britishness

A mere three weeks after the Colstonoclasm of Bristol, the nation's moral guide by royal appointment has condescended to mince his way into the discussion. The Archbishop of Canterbury recommended forgiving the trespasses of slave traders, much as future generations will doubtless be required to forgive those of oil company executives. He noted that Jesus is portrayed in many different ways depending on whether the local culture happens to be racist, homophobic, misogynistic or cosily hypocritical, and demonstrated the unique Christian brand of humility by proclaiming the "universality" of his own peculiar sect of the Abrahamic delusion. Concerning the monuments in and around Canterbury Cathedral, the Archbishop is virtuously prepared to tolerate the removal of various motes from his neighbours' eyes, but understandably draws the line at taking down any graven images from inside the cathedral itself.
